The renewal of our combined liability and fleet cover with Merrivale Assurance concludes this quarter. Premiums rise 9%, reflecting two claims on the Dunmore corridor and broader market hardening. We negotiated an improved deductible structure and extended cover to the new Caldris depot. Alternative quotes from two underwriters were materially worse. We recommend approving renewal at the stated terms. The strategic reasoning behind this recommendation is set out in the confidential note that follows.

confidential, bahof-yaweg: Headcount on the Kaseth team goes from 32 to 109 by the end of January. Gross margin on Kaseth came in at 46 percent against a plan of 45 percent.

Ticket: Sketchloom diagram editor — undo/redo stack fix. Redo currently loses connector styling after a group move; the patch snapshots edge attributes alongside node positions. Keep the history cap at 200 steps, it's there for memory reasons. Contractors: test with nested groups before pushing. This change can't merge until we get sign-off from the reviewer named below.

named custodian: Brivan Eliath Quenox Frador

## Changelog — SproutCue 2.4

Heads up: we changed some defaults in the watering scheduler. Quiet hours now default to on (no pump runs overnight), and the moisture-sensor polling interval dropped from 30 to 10 minutes. Retry backoff for flaky valve controllers is also gentler now, so logs should be less noisy. Nothing else moved, but since defaults shifted, please re-audit. Current shipped defaults are below.

service settings:
[casax]
port = 6379
team = rusir
host = casax.zemvarhq.corp
region = outer-4
access_code = ac_9808ce
timeout_ms = 1500

Subject: Insurance Renewal — Action Needed

Team, and a warm welcome to our incoming director: the Amberline policy renews next quarter. Broker quotes from Fennet & Roake show an 11% premium rise, partly offset by improved liability terms. I recommend renewal with the revised deductible. The decision should be read alongside the note below.

board note of fahag-tajop: The eastern region missed its Julix quota by 44.0 percent last quarter. Ralionax Holdings plans to lower the Druath list price by 61.8 percent in March. The board signed off on a budget of $295.0 million for Project Gilath. The renewal with Ruswynix Systems closes at $274.5 million a year, 17.0 percent above the last contract.